Standard causes

There can be various reasons for the Hair loss louisville if your child is 26 months old or even older. It is essential to visit an experienced paediatrician who will be able o diagnose appropriately to start the treatment as soon as possible. A widespread reason is the ringworm of the scalp. Doctors like to designate it as Tinea capitis. It is a type of fungal infection. The symptoms may show up in various ways. But the most common form involves developing scaly patches where the hair fall occurs. The hair usually breaks off, and the scalp appears to have tiny dots all over.


 
Tests for confirmation

No pediatric dermatologist louisville ky takes a chance in the treatment of children. That is why, even if the doctor is sure about the cause, still the person will suggest a microscopic examination. The confirmation of eh diagnosis will help the paediatrician to prescribe oral antifungal medicines for two months immediately. Often, the doctor will also specify the use of antifungal shampoo that will decrease the shedding. Also, avoid sharing the pillows or hair brush of your child with other children as the disease is contagious.

Alopecia areata

This condition is non-contagious. It is a dysfunction of the child’s immune system that starts to attack the hair follicles. You will suddenly notice oval or round patches from where the hair loss will take place. Unfortunately, there is no permanent cure for the condition. However, the treatment procedure can control the disease. Moreover, the paediatrician will provide medicines for hair regrowth. In some worse cases, the child will also lose hair from all over the body.
